How It Works

At a high level, WhatsApp Activity is integrated into your Journey Builder (JB) flow.

Once configured, it acts as a step in the journey:

  • A player reaches a specific stage;
  • The system evaluates conditions;
  • A WhatsApp message is triggered.

From a system perspective, each message follows a clear lifecycle:

  • Sent to provider – successfully delivered to WhatsApp;
  • Not sent – blocked due to validation or delivery issues.

Built on Approved Templates

WhatsApp messaging is template-driven - and that’s a good thing.

Instead of free-form messages, you use pre-approved templates tied to your WhatsApp Business account. This ensures compliance and consistent message quality.

Each template can include:

  • Dynamic variables (for personalization);
  • Links (with tracking and autologin support);
  • Localized content per language.

As shown in the configuration screen (page 3), templates are selected per language, ensuring players receive messages in the right context.

Personalization with Variables

Templates support dynamic placeholders such as:

{{1}} – tournament name;

{{2}} – bonus percentage.

These are mapped during setup using available variables, allowing you to create messages that feel personal without manual effort and support more effective personalized player communication.

Technical Setup (What You Actually Need)

To enable WhatsApp Activity, there’s a one-time setup process involving Meta (WhatsApp’s platform).

You’ll need:

  • Meta Developer account;
  • WhatsApp Business account (verified);
  • Approved message templates;
  • API credentials, including:
    • API token;
    • Phone Number ID;
    • WhatsApp Business Account ID.

These are configured via the WhatsApp API setup (shown on page 2) and connected to your platform through structured WhatsApp CRM integration.

Smart Link Handling and Tracking

One of the most powerful features is how links are handled.

You can configure:

  • Autologin – automatically log the player into your platform;
  • Shorten & Track – generate trackable short links.

This turns each message into a measurable interaction point.

For example:

  • A player receives a bonus message;
  • Clicks the link;
  • Lands directly in the sportsbook, already logged in.

This removes friction and improves conversion.

Message Control and Testing

Before going live, you can test messages directly from the CMS.

You can send test messages:

  • By Player ID;
  • By phone number.

You can also define:

  • Expiration time (how long the message is valid);
  • Target recipients;
  • Variable behavior.

The test configuration panel (page 4) ensures everything works as expected before launching campaigns.

Real-Time Feedback and Error Handling

Not every message will be delivered — and the system makes that transparent.

Common reasons for failure include:

  • Invalid phone number;
  • Incorrect URL format;
  • Player unsubscribed from WhatsApp;
  • Template not approved or changed.

These outcomes are logged in the Journey Log, giving you clear visibility into message performance and issues.

Versioning and Live Updates

WhatsApp Activity also supports message versioning, which is critical for live operations.

As shown on page 5:

  • You can update message content even after a journey is created;
  • Each update creates a new version;
  • Changes apply only after the journey is republished.

This allows you to refine messaging without disrupting active flows.
